Job Title: 2nd Shift General Labor
Job Description
This role supports production by operating and loading plastic film machines, handling heavy rolls of plastic, and assisting with packaging tasks on the 2nd shift. You will work as a flexible floater, helping wherever needed to keep machines running smoothly, materials moving efficiently, and finished products packaged accurately according to specifications.
Essential Skills
- Minimum 6 months of machine operation experience in any production environment.
- Ability to read and use a tape measure accurately for measuring materials and cutting to length.
- Capability to lift and handle heavy rolls of plastic weighing around 50 pounds.
- Experience performing manual labor in a manufacturing, production, or general labor setting.
- Comfort working with hand tools for cutting, trimming, and packaging tasks.
- Willingness and physical ability to hustle and keep up with steady production demands.
- Mechanical inclination and comfort working with machines and basic production equipment.
- Reliability and consistency in following instructions and adhering to safety guidelines.

Work Environment
This position is on the 2nd shift, working from 3:00 p.m. to 11:15 p.m., in a manufacturing facility that produces custom polyethylene film products. The environment is described as very clean, dry, and not loud, with steady work and consistent production demands. You will work on and around plastic film machines, handling rolls of plastic, loading and unloading materials, and using basic hand tools and tape measures. The crew is small, so teamwork, flexibility, and the ability to step into different tasks as needed are important. The pace requires individuals to hustle to keep up with production while maintaining safety and quality. The dress code includes boots, jeans, and a T-shirt or sweatshirt. Safety glasses are required and provided by the employer.
